To act as an advanced physiotherapy clinical practitioner within the Orthopaedic Outpatient Consultant Clinics for designated orthopaedic specialty using advanced clinical reasoning skills to provide specialist support and advice to physiotherapy and other clinical staff whilst maintaining a caseload of highly complex patients referred to the service as an autonomous practitioner. They will use advanced clinical decision making and expertise to guide and support treatment pathways ensuring the delivery of a clear pathway and rehabilitation plans., 1. To undertake as an advanced autonomous practitioner, comprehensive assessments of highly complex patients presenting with multiple pathologies, using advanced bio psychosocial clinical reasoning skills, expert knowledge of evidence-based practice, and, 1. To demonstrate specialist musculoskeletal knowledge related to screening, assessment, investigation, triage and treatment, underpinned by theoretical knowledge or relevant practical experience. 2. 1. To manage patients referred to the Orthopaedic specialty clinic for initial contact, assessment, clinical diagnosis and management; acting as a link clinician to support them through the clinical pathway.

  • Qualified and HCPC registered physiotherapist
  • -Experience of working as a band 6 physiotherapist for a minimum of three years in MSK.
  • Educated to Master's degree level or or currently registered and studying at Masters level.
  • Experience of working in all core areas, QI expereience
  • GCP training
  • Membership of a professional network / CIG

Oxford University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ust is one of the largest NHS teaching trusts in the country. It provides a wide range of general and specialist clinical services and is a base for medical education, training and research. The Trust comprises four hospitals - the John Radcliffe Hospital, Churchill Hospital and Nuffield Orthopaedic Centre in Headington and the Horton General Hospital in Banbury.
